PGS S50: Game 8 : Anaheim Outlaws vs Vancouver Whalers
#1

[Image: Outlaws2.png] vs. [Image: Vancouver.png]

1-5


Game 8 marks the rematch between these two teams who are ready for a team death-match once again. It was a bitter start for the Whalers as their first game of the season was against the Outlaws, which ended in their defeat. It was a well fought out war between the two nonetheless, as the Outlaws only won by 1 goal. The Whalers were looking to turn things around this time as their defeat left them with a hunger for victory.

Game Recap


Period 1

The game begins and only a minute and a half in, Jean-Paul Boivin charges at Ivan Maximus like a raging bull. This lands the Anaheim Outlaws a powerplay opportunity. I don't know if it was their lack of motivation or lack of powerplay ability, but the Outlaws were getting pummeled by the Whalers on their own powerplay. Jan Zacha who I think forgot to take his chill pill was going all out crazy, as if he took some sort of adrenaline. Zacha then wins the face-off in the Anaheim Zone and rushes on a breakaway and takes a quick wrister at the opposition. Boomm it goes in and the Whalers have just scored a short handed goal to get a 1 goal lead on the Outlaws. 12 minutes into the period, rookie defenseman from Sweden, Zlatan Ibrahimovic Jr, takes a bone shivering slap shot at the Tobias Lindeman, which results in a rebout. Cullen Gray is able to capitalize on this chance and scores an easy tap in to give the whalers a two goal lead. The period ends with not much happening afterwards. Shot totals heavily favors the Whalers with 18-11. The whalers have completely dominated the game so far.

Period 2

The period resumes and 2 minutes in, the rookie, Stracimir Petrovic, dishes a nice pass to Sureshot Dombrowski, who undeniably does take a sureshot and extends the lead to 3-0. It's a freaking onslaught out here and the Whalers are pummeling the Outlaws to ashes. The scoreline only gets worse after Jean-Paul Boivin and Bobby Bobcalf score goals 4 and 5. It's as if the outlaws have given up and are allowing the massacre. The period ends and the crowd goes crazy. A lot of booing and laughter can be heard aiming at the Outlaws. Without a response, the Outlaws sulk and walk away in despair. The period ends 5-0 in favor of the Whalers.

Period 3

This period was slow as hell. Whalers were so far up ahead that they entered the game after sipping on some good vodka. You can notice their lethargic movements on the ice and how Ibra Jr was just hollering at the fans in the rink. Ivan Maximus took advantage of this and scored a goal but that was it for them. Nothing else, they were already defeated in spirit that they had nothing else going for them. The game ends with a score of 5-1 for the Whalers.

Key Factor

The key factor that led to the Whaler's victory is without a doubt their goaltender, Kasperi Braulin, the German Veteran standing at 6'3". The man was just brilliant stopping 26 out of the 27 shots he faced.
